Qatar Assumes Co-Chairmanship of Group of Friends of Sport for Development and Peace

New York, June 21 (QNA) - The State of Qatar has been selected as Co-Chair of the Group of Friends of Sport for Development and Peace, jointly with the Principality of Monaco.

Qatar's succeeded Tunisia in the Co-chairmanship of the group, which focused mainly on the great contributions of sport to sustainable development and peace; promoting tolerance and respect and empowering individuals and communities as emphasized in the 2030 Sustainable Development Plan.

HE Permanent Representative of the State of Qatar to the United Nations Ambassador Sheikha Alya Ahmed bin Saif Al-Thani, affirmed that the State of Qatar, through its co-chairmanship with the Principality of Monaco, will continue to build on the achievements made during Tunisia's term as Co-chair of the group, so that the Group of Friends can remain a common platform for promoting dialogue, exchange of views and information and facilitating and encouraging the integration of sport to achieve the goals and objectives of the United Nations.

The Group of Friends for Sport for Development and Peace was established in 2003 at the initiative of Tunisia and Switzerland.

Selecting Qatar for the Co-Chairmanship of the Group of Friends of Sport for Development and Peace come as an affirmation of its continued efforts in investing sports to create an environment of understanding and to promote cooperation, solidarity and peace at the national, regional and international levels.
